Merging with Causal Structure[edit]

The two concepts, while closely related, are quite different. The article on Causal Structure provides the mathematical definitions. The article on Causality Conditions provides a physical interpretation of certain conditions on the properties of those mathematical definitions. Joining the two articles will confuse this distinction. BenWhale (talk) 23:29, 19 June 2011 (UTC)[reply]
